Which scenario seems more appealing for you in building your MLM business:
Scenario 1: The Chase ‘Em Down Method.
You sit down and write your list. This list is people you’ve known, people you’ve forgotten, people who have forgotten you, people you never knew but you somehow have a business card from them in your car, etc… You learn a sales pitch and you begin dialing for dollars. You have folks who remember you, folks who don’t remember you. You leave voice mails, hoping the voice mail was enticing enough to get a call back. Some of the folks you talk to might even agree to come to your meeting or check out your web site. Of those, most won’t actually make it. Sounds like a tough way to build a business.
Still, this method works and some successful network marketers swear by it.
Scenario 2: The Bring ‘Em In Method. (Generating Opt in mlm leads)
This is where you set up your blog and social media to share your success stories and the success stories of your team members. Maybe you’re sharing your weight loss journey, your marketing stories, or whatever is happening with you as relates to the products and services you are using.
You let your friends know about your journey and they can follow you on their favorite social media sites. You drive traffic to your blog. You network with other people in and around your area. Your business card has the web site for your blog (not a distributor web site from the company). You participated in related discussion groups and forums. You provide real feedback and contribute to the conversation in a meaningful way.
Your blog has a form where visitors who are interested can request more information, a sample, etc… When they fill out that form, they receive the letters you have written that explains how you can help them get better results, have a better experience, or build an additional income stream. This is a true opt in mlm lead. When they fill out the form on your blog, they are opting in to receive your information. Your email marketing autoresponder then handles the follow up, keeping your information in front of them, and establishing you as a professional in your field.
This doesn’t mean that they are ready to join. It simply means they are interested in learning more. Your autoresponder handles the followup, sending your information, and keeping these leads updated.
Opt in mlm leads have requested information from you.
Typically, by the time they begin reaching out to you for questions, they are pretty well ready to join your team. They just need to know you are real and available to work with them.
